Medical professionals here at The Foot Institute – Red Deer focus on the surgical and medical therapy of the foot and ankle. Our doctors invest around 10 years in higher education, the first 4 years in undergraduate studies to obtain a Bachelors Degree, and the next 4 years in Medical School to get a Podiatric Medical Degree. Podiatric Medical School is similar to typical medical school and in fact several podiatry training programs lie inside these schools. After acquiring a Podiatric Medial Degree, Doctors at the Foot Institute perform a hospital "internship" or post degree residency for another one to three years.

At the conclusion of the internship or residency, our Podiatrists have acquired wide-ranging health care training with an emphasis on complications regarding the ankles and feet. Foot Institute Doctors are skilled to treat problems ranging from basic ailments for instance fungal and ingrown toenails, to those which are more complicated like clubfoot, bunions, or reconstructive surgery of the foot. Our physicians have substantial surgical education which supply them the experience essential to carry out surgery on those problems that are best handled through surgical intervention.

Doctors at the Foot Institute also have a thorough practical knowledge and understanding of biomechanics, which is the study of the forces which the legs and feet go through as we walk, run or perform other tasks. Learning about biomechanics and gait deviations enables a Podiatrist to develop shoes and orthotics which can deliver pain relief and help prevent countless problems which the feet regularly experience.
